Welcome to Theatre at the Mount


Theatre at the Mount, located in the Fine Arts Wing of Mount Wachusett Community College, 444 Green Street in Gardner is Central Mass' Premier Community Theatre!

We seat 550 people in 15 unobstructed rows so every seat has a great view of the action! The theatre is wheelchair accessible and listening devices are available for the hearing impaired.
Refreshments are provided by Oakmont Regional High School's music parent group and sold in the lobby during intermission. All shows begin promptly at times indicated, so please plan accordingly. Cash preferred at the door. Reservations recommended.

Children's Shows Each April and October we present shows especially for children. The spring show runs for one week, with two performances each weekday here at the college (for school groups) and one on Saturday for the general public. In the fall, we take the show to you for performances in your cafeteria, gym or auditorium space on weekdays and perform one show here on our stage.

Ushers Always Needed
8-10 volunteer ushers are needed for each performance; 2 people to take tickets, 2 people to distribute programs, 2-4 people to direct/escort people to their seats and 2 people to assist with seating in the lower section.
Please arrive 45 minutes before show time and upon arrival, do a "sweep" of the theatre to pick up any trash or lost items. Organize programs so as to make it easy to distribute them, and leave boxes accesssible so that patrons can deposit used programs in them on their way out. Be sure that companion chairs are available near the back of the theatre for persons accompanying a wheelchair. Assist latecomers in finding their seats during breaks in the action onstage. Stay until all patrons have exited the theatre after the show.
